“”In 2004, President Bush got a whopping 68% of voters who identified themselves as Latino Protestants who attended church weekly,” Dallas Morning News columnist William McKenzie writes today. “They weren’t a dominant part of the Bush base, reports pollster John Green of the Pew Forum on Religion & Public Life. But, as Mr. Green told me, swing groups like this matter immensely in these close elections we’ve been having.”
Now, Latino evangelical leaders tell McKenzie that the collapse of a bipartisan immigration bill earlier this year could come back to hurt Republican candidates in 2008 if they’re looking for support from conservative Latino Christians.”
